Long & Houston - Ellis
250 W Long Ave
Fort Worth, TX 76106
The Long & Houston - Ellis bus stop is conveniently located in Fort Worth, TX, serving as a vital point for local commuters. Surrounded by a mix of residential and commercial spaces, it offers easy access to nearby amenities and public transportation options. The area is characterized by a blend of urban life and Texas charm, making it a practical stop for daily travelers in the bustling city.
Generated from this place's information
See a problem?
